BrewDog Black Hammer

Black Hammer

 

BrewDog in Ellon, Aberdeenshire, Scotland 🏴󠁧󠁢󠁳󠁣󠁴󠁿

  IPA - Black / Cascadian Dark Regular Out of Production
Score
7.38
ABV: 7.2% IBU: 200 Ticks: 97
Dark Malt and American hops unite to bring a new age of bitterness. Pithy grapefruit and resin combine with a dark chocolate and roasty coffee hit to deliver a resonating bitterness that goes beyond IBUs.

8.4/10 Appearance 8 Aroma 8 Flavor 9 Texture 8 Overall 8.5
Can at home. Expired a short time ago but still tastes as when fresh, hop aromas has not been lost. Pours black with a lot of initial head, dissipates very quickly though leaving almost no foam. Aroma is more on the malts’ side, a lot of roastiness coming through. Quite a bit coffee, some chocolate and licorice, pine and a herbal earthiness from the hops, not a lot of fruit. Light to medium body. Flavour: fruity at first, followed by bitterness and pine, finishes roasty and warming. Definitely some grapefruit, chocolate, some coffee. Nice balance of maltiness and hoppiness, also not too intensely piney. Finish is a very nice mix of dark malts and the herbal earthiness from the hops (I’m just guessing Mosaic here) and a lot of bitterness. Excellent!

7.6/10 Appearance 8 Aroma 7 Flavor 8 Texture 8 Overall 7.5
330 ml can. Pours with a deep, black color and a nice tan head. First impression of fat, roasted malts. Followed by fruity aromas with a nice grapefruit-peel and hoppy note. Taste is quiet good: lots of roated malts, citrus and a nice touch which reminds me of barrel-aging. Long lasting finish with coffee and dried fruits. Good balanced.
